How much do temporary resilience insurance analytics j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for temporary resilience insurance analytics in Naperville, IL is $58,345.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39,900.00 and $73,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Manager, Data Strategy & Analytics

The Manager, Data Strategy & Analytics is responsible for guiding and supporting all facets of CRM analytics projects. As a key member of the Data Intelligence team, this includes preparing and presenting analytic strategies, measurement and reporting for CRM digital and non-digital marketing campaigns and making proactive recommendations that drive the key performance goals of our clients.

Responsibilities
  • Subject matter expert for marketing automation tech, analytical tools and techniques, including Marketo, SQL, Tableau, Adobe Analytics, and analytics software packages
  • Campaign Automation tools, Marketo specifically from a reporting and segmentation perspective.
  • Strong data storytelling and adept at communicating technical subject matter to non-technical stakeholders
  • Develop and present analyses, POVs, reporting results, key insights, and recommendations to client stakeholders
  • Manage, train, and provide on-going leadership and mentorship to Data Analysts
  • As required/appropriate, perform hands-on data investigation and analysis in support of program delivery, including development of conclusions and implications
  • Manage projects that primarily focus on performance of marketing activities (including but not limited to online and offline CRM direct marketing, cross-channel campaigns, digital advertising, promotional activities)
  • Accurately and effectively estimate level of effort for analytics projects
  • Define measurement strategies for clients, inclusive of timely and comprehensive reporting and dashboards with an objective to evaluate marketing performance, drive valuable insights, and provide recommendations for optimization
  • Ensures consistent, relevant, and actionable KPIs are used to optimize and influence strategic decisions
  • Proactively identify, evaluate, and recommend, A/B testing opportunities, reporting requirements, other relevant tools and applications
  • Identify research and analytics initiatives to support strategy development
  • Create business cases for successful analytics initiatives
  • Design and manage strategic analytic roadmaps for clients
Qualifications
  • You have marketing agency experience (preferred)
  • Minimum of 5-7 years direct experience in CRM or marketing analytics
  • Hands-on experience with Marketo
  • You have awareness/experience with advanced analytic techniques, such as multivariate regression analysis, predictive modeling, logistic regression, factor analysis, forecasting, response prediction, advertising effectiveness, consumer profiling, market mix and ROI measurement
  • You have experience developing strategic analytic roadmaps and managing projects and teams to effectively deliver them
  • You have hands-on experience with data visualization and analytic dashboard development, experience with Tableau (preferred), Looker, Power BI, or other platforms
  • You have thorough knowledge and hands-on experience with informing marketing strategy, analytics design and delivery
  • You have a working knowledge of site analytics suites, Adobe Analytics (preferred), Google Analytics,
  • Ability to craft innovative strategies and approaches to analyze marketing performance and deliver powerful insights and recommendations
  • Ability to manage internal resources/team members at varying levels including junior talent
  • Strong ability to work in a flexible, dynamic and fast-paced environment
  • Self-starter with demonstrated instinct for developing insights from data
  • Excellent communication skills, including written, presentation, and storytelling
